Transaction 911c3289470fecfe40eed354c26ea559ed540f0ef37eb92e71ddcfedca208069
1 Input
2 Outputs
- 911c3289470fecfe40eed354c26ea559ed540f0ef37eb92e71ddcfedca208069:0
- 911c3289470fecfe40eed354c26ea559ed540f0ef37eb92e71ddcfedca208069:1
value 58000000
address 3HkH1fGfTiJmA7AGPrVyutH2MjqGf28ADe
value 1909094890
address 13NFEiK8CFjosf6giN85e46CuduJi61Nc2